Mission

Girl Scouts’ mission is “to build girls of courage, confidence, and character, who make the world a better place." Girl Scouts unleashes the G.I.R.L. (Go-getter, Innovator, Risk-taker, Leader) in every girl, preparing her for a lifetime of leadership—from taking a night-time hike under the stars to accepting a mission on the International Space Station; from lobbying the city council with her troop to holding a seat in Congress; from running her own cookie business today to tackling the nation's cybersecurity tomorrow. The Girl Scout Leadership Experience, or GSLE, is a one-of-a-kind leadership development program for girls, with proven results. The GSLE is based on time-tested methods and research-backed programming that help girls take the lead in their own lives and in the world. Research shows that girls learn best in an all-girl, girl-led, and girl-friendly environment. The inclusive, all-female environment of a Girl Scout troop creates a safe space where girls can try new things, develop a range of skills, take on leadership roles, and just be themselves. Girl Scouts is a place where girls practice different skills, explore their potential, and even feel allowed to fail, dust themselves off, get up, and try again. Girl Scouts is proven to help girls thrive in five key ways as they: Develop a strong sense of selfSeek challenges and learn from setbacks Display positive valuesForm and maintain healthy relationshipsIdentify and solve problems in the communityPut simply, in Girl Scouts, girls discover who they are, connect with others, and take action to make the world a better place.

About

SINCE THE MAJORITY OF GIRL SCOUT PROGRAMMING IS PROVIDED BY OUR DEDICATED VOLUNTEERS, SUPPORTING THEIR EFFORTS IS A TOP PRIORITY. OUR TEAM ENSURES MONTHLY COMMUNICATION WITH EACH LEADER AND PROVIDES IDEAS AND ASSISTANCE WITH MEETING BADGE REQUIREMENTS. TRAININGS ON LEADING GIRLS IN THE OUTDOORS, STEM, AND GIRL LEAD PROGRAMMING ARE PROVIDED TYPICALLY EACH QUARTER. WE ALSO PROVIDE TRAININGS DIRECTLY TO OUR GIRL MEMBERS TO HELP THEM ACHIEVE AWARDS SUCH AS THE BRONZE, SILVER, AND GOLD AWARD. IN ADDITION WE HOST COUNCIL WIDE EVENTS FOR ALL GIRLS IN OUR REGION. THESE EVENTS RANGE FROM SERVING 100 TO 1000 GIRLS AT A SINGLE EVENT.

Interesting data from their 2020 990 filing

The non-profit's mission, as described in the filing, is “The mission is to build girls of courage, confidence and character who make the world a better place. the organization provides and directs girl scout programs for girls ages 5 to 17 in 39 counties in oklahoma.”.

When describing its duties, they were characterized as: “To build girls of courage, confidence,and character who make the world a better place. provides girl scout programs for girls ages 5 - 17 in 39 counties in oklahoma”.

  • The non-profit has complied with legal regulations by reporting their state of operation as OK.
  • The filing shows that the non-profit's address as of 2020 is 6100 N ROBINSON AVENUE, OKLAHOMA CITY, OK, 73118.
  • As of 2020, the non-profit has reported a total of 75 employees on their form.
